The Benefits of Double Glazed Windows
Double-glazed windows can provide a variety of enjoyable benefits for homeowners. They can help reduce energy bills and improve the appearance of a home.
They also reduce noise pollution in the home. The air gap between the glass panes provides an additional layer of insulation and reduces heat loss in winter and lessening unwanted solar gain in summer.
uPVC
uPVC is a cost-effective and durable material for double-glazed windows. It can resist a wide range of climate temperatures and is not biodegradable unlike wood, which could rot or be harmed by pests. In addition, uPVC is a recyclable material that can be reshaped into new shapes and forms.
Double-glazed windows consist of two panes enclosed in frames made of uPVC or aluminum. The gap between the panes of glass is filled with insulating gases like Krypton or argon, which enhances the thermal performance and acoustic quality.
Double-glazed windows are more resilient to strong winds and harsh sun than single-paned ones. They also are highly resistant to chemicals and are equipped with multi-point high-security locks to ensure extra security.
uPVC windows are very low maintenance and will keep looking nice. The only thing they need is a quick wipe down periodically with a damp cloth to get rid of any grime that has built up. uPVC is available in a broad range of colours and finishes that can be tailored to match the style of your home. Secondary glazing
Secondary glazing is a straightforward and inexpensive way to increase the efficiency of a property. It's a good alternative to double-glazing and has many of the same advantages, such as reducing cold draughts, getting rid of external noise, and increasing energy efficiency. It also adds an extra layer of security to your home.

It is essential that the secondary glazing doesn't hinder access to the original opening window for maintenance and cleaning. To minimize the chance that condensation could form in the future, it is important to ensure that the gaps between original and secondary glass are well ventilated. It is also essential to ensure that the acoustic insulation quality of the secondary glazing is maintained, particularly with a greater gap.
Aside from the above It is essential to make sure that windows are in good order and sound prior to attempting any improvement work. If not, it is likely that repairs will be required prior to any work to improve them can begin. In some cases this may require the issuance of a Listed Building Consent to replace the window repair luton in question with a double-glazed unit.

Although aluminium and uPVC windows and doors near me are often advertised as maintenance-free, they still require regular maintenance to stay in good shape. It is recommended to clean your uPVC windows and doors with a gentle, non-abrasive cleaner. Do not use a liquid for washing up since it can cause damage to seals and mechanisms. You can use a squeegee to remove stubborn dirt from uPVC frames and sills. Cleaning your uPVC windows and doors clean will allow them to last longer and stop unnecessary wear and wear and tear. It is also a good idea to check the locks on your uPVC doors and windows regularly to ensure they're working properly.
